Запуск программы невозможен так как отсутствует msvcp100.dll. Где скачать этот файл?
Столкнувшись с ошибкой, когда отсутствует файл msvcp100.dll, а потому запуск программы не возможен не стоит сразу же лезть в интернет и пытаться скачать его с первого попавшегося файлообменника или торрента. Вполне вероятно, что там спрятан вирус или троян, потом будете гуглить способы убрать рекламу в браузере.
Лучше, когда файлы качаются с официальных, проверенных источников, тем более проблемы где взять оригинальный файл msvcp100.dll не существует — это системная библиотека, которая входит в состав «Распространяемый пакет Visual C++ для Visual Studio 2012 Обновление 4» для Windows x32 — x64
Ссылки для скачивания MSVCP100.DLL
Рекомендуем устанавливать универсальный пакет Microsoft Visual C++ 2005-2008-2010-2012-2013-2019 Redistributable Package Hybrid нужной вам битности. Если вы устанавливаете отдельный пакет Microsoft Visual C++ 2010, необходимо устанавливать x32 и x64 версию, так как многие программы требуют именно 32-битную версию библиотек. ЕСЛИ НЕ ЗНАЕТЕ, ЧТО СКАЧИВАТЬ — ЧИТАЙТЕ ОПИСАНИЕ ВЫШЕ
Уважаемые посетители, мы стараемся своевременно обновлять бесплатные программы, размещенные на нашем портале и тщательно проверяем их антивирусами перед загрузкой на сервер. Скорее всего, у нас можно бесплатно скачать самую последнюю версию программы MSVCP100.DLL, однако мы не можем гарантировать 100% безопасность программ размещенных на сайтах разработчиков, поэтому снимаем с себя ответственность за любой возможный вред от их использования.
На каких системах встречается?
Ошибке подвержена каждая система:
- Windows XP SP1
- Windows 7 x86 / x64
- Windows 8 x86 / x64
- Windows 8.1 x86 / x64
- Windows 10 x86 / x64
Проблема встречается, если у вас нелицензионное ПО, по каким-то определенным причинами из таких версий вырезают часть библиотек, а так же если вы скачиваете игры и программы через торренты..
Второй способ
Иногда ошибка Msvcr100.dll возникает из-за того что этот файл находиться не там, где его хочет видеть операционная система. Если точнее, то в 64-битных ОС он должен располагаться в папке SysWOW64 внутри раздела Windows. В таких случаях нужно:
Когда первые два способа не помогли, есть еще один метод решения проблемы – ручная установка и регистрация файла Msvcr100.dll. Для этого следует:
- Скачать Msvcr100.dll с ресурса, которому вы доверяете. Также можно попросить друзей, чтобы они переслали вам данный файл. Это нужно чтобы быть на 100% были уверенным в работоспособности Msvcr100.dll.
- Полученный файл нужно скопировать в папку С:Windowssystem32.
- Также файл нужно скопировать в папку С:Windows SysWOW64, если у вас 64-х битная ОС.
- Далее, в сроке поиска меню «Пуск» вводим «regsvr MSVCR100.dll» и нажимаем клавишу Enter.
Аналогичное можно сделать нажав клавиши «Win+R»,вызвав меню «Выполнить» где также вводим «regsvr MSVCR100.dll» и кликаем по «Оk». - Если операционная система говорит о невозможности выполнения данной команды, то вместо «regsvr MSVCR100.dll» вводим «regsvr32 MSVCR100.dll».
- Ждем пока система выполнит команду, и перезагружаем компьютер.
Переустановка среды разработки приложений Microsoft Visual C++
Чаще всего этот способ помогает и никаких ручных действий не требует, но мы рассмотрим и случаи, когда возникают проблемы с автоматическим приложением.
1. Скачайте платформу с официального сайта Microsoft по ссылке https://www.microsoft.com/ru-ru/download/details.aspx?id=48145, выберите один из файлов, который соответствует разрядности вашей операционной системы Х64 или Х32;
2. Запустите установщик и проследуйте инструкции, приложение само восстановит файл, который отсутствует.
3. Перезагрузите компьютер.
Этот вариант вам должен помочь, проверьте Windows, после перезагрузки, на предмет ошибки, в частности, то приложение, которое до этого отказывалось работать. Если у вас не получилось восстановить работоспособность приложения, попробуйте удалить эту библиотеку и установить снова пакет Microsoft Visual C++.
Запуск невозможен,так как на компьютере отсутствует msvcr100-dll
1) попробовать обновить directx
2) c++ сначала снести подчистую (с помощью какой-нибудь удаляющей утилиты), а потом установить по новой.
batmanoftheyear
Скопируйте msvcr100.dll в директорию C:windowssystem32, в папку с игрой и в папку application если такая имеется в том месте куда вы инсталлировали игру. На примере игры masseffect, dll-msvcr100 кидать в директории: «C:windowssystem32», C:gamesmasseffect и C:gamesmasseffectapplication, после чего перезапустить компьютер. Данная процедура помогает в большинстве случаев.
batmanoftheyear
net framework 4.5 Стоит,откуда качал Microsoft Visual C++(надо с оф.сайта,там выбор системы и в путь)!?
Дирек Х сойдёт и с игрой -только желательно его отдельно запустить и с вкл.инетом!
lookaway
Можешь удалить лишние(старые)
Не забивайте старым фуфлом систему!Даже если идут с игрой!
Больше этого ненужно!» 2008года тоже уже можно удалять! У себя сам не заметил как с чем-то опять 2008 установил,ща удалю!
net framework 4.5 тоже только он нужен,старые версии тоже к фигам удаляйте(если есть)!
Тем более,что старьё встроено в любую современную систему,но не активированы -если понадобится, в ручную можно запустить,но только даже для старых приложениях- уже нафиг ненадо!